Cold Water Expansion Valve

My last blog was on a Hot Water Cylinder relief drain.

Connected to the relief drain is a cold water expansion valve. This is an energy saving device, generally situated low on the system. It is designed to relieve the pressure that is created when water heats up. The valve operates on a certain pressure and is factory set, due to this no maintenance can be carried out on the valve, however, these very rarely fail. This is the valve that will cause the constant drip via the relief drain, which should be cold water. The valve works in unison with the Temperature and Pressure Relief Valve which I will discuss on my next blog.
